Parking Eye took charge of the car park of the local gym, health centre and swimming pool a few months back. Since then I have received between 20 and 30 parking notices demanding payment. Each of these notices was incorrect and I appealed and they were cancelled. The stress and time wasted doing this has really done my head in. I have been fighting stage four cancer and have a blue badge. I always park correctly display my blue badge and enter my registration. Why do they keep sending the Parking notices? Is it a sinister scam in which they send out to everyone in the hope that some people just pay because they are afraid? I now have three more notices. Two are from are for a 20 minute drop-off when I was clearly parked in a nearby 3-hour space!! Now I did park in the 20-minute space on one occasion and overstayed by 29 minutes. I appealed because of mitigating circumstances. I went to the health centre to weigh myself and met a friend of mine and her young son. She was in tears and distraught because her father had just died of mouth cancer. I am a trustee at a local cancer group so I supported her. I stayed with her and her son before taking them to visit her new father's grave before dropping them off at home. She was in tears all the way. I appealed on the grounds of compassion but Parking Eye just want money. I am NEVER going to pay this scumbag company. I will seek legal advice with regards to suing them for constant parking notices when I parked correctly. I have already contacted my local MP and am considering contacting the media too. This **** is not doing my poor health any good. I am alone with my nine-year old son and may well cancel his swimming lessons because of the bombardment by Parking Eye. Thoughts and HELP please

I didn't get a ticket on my car. They sent Parking Charge notices to my address. I have had over 30 of them. A handful of them was because I had either forgotten to enter my reg number or had entered it incorrectly. The vast majority were for parking in a 20-minute drop off zone when in fact I had parked in a disabled bay and displayed my blue badge. Once I appealed they were cancelled. One was because I overstayed by 29 minutes when I did park in a 20-minute drop off zone. I appealed on the grounds of mitigating circumstances because I was comforting a woman whose father had just died of cancer. After explaining this to the land-owner all of my outstanding Parking charge notices including the 29-minute overstay have been cancelled. Plus a white ticket to park anytime. Good result.
